The 135 Autocarrier is a system for automated camera scanning. Film is fed through the carrier at an impressive speed of up to three frames per second. Your camera is triggered automatically. Each frame is pressed down and held in place by a magnetic pressure plate made by BOBACH. The same principle and the exact same pressure plates are used in professional Fuji Frontier film scanners. Twenty full-spectrum LEDs provide exceptional color accuracy and even illumination of the full frame. The LED brightness is fixed in a way to allow capture at medium aperture and low ISO, ensuring maximum sharpness and minimal sensor noise.
In automatic mode, our custom designed frame sensor detects and positions each frame on the film strip with pinpoint accuracy, guaranteeing consistent, perfect alignment across every scan. Besides the automatic mode, the Autocarrier can also be used in manual mode, where the film is moved manually using the control panel wheel, which is crafted to deliver exceptional haptic feedback for both precision and speed. The camera can be triggered easily with a dedicated button on the control panel, streamlining the scanning process.
Lastly, the Autocarrier offers a semi-automatic mode. In this mode, the film strip is automatically advanced by a fixed (adjustable) distance after each camera release. Semi-automatic mode is ideal for a rapid workflow when automatic frame detection is challenging - such as with slide film or heavily underexposed frames that are difficult to detect accurately.

Which cameras are compatible with the Autocarrier?
All cameras which have a remote trigger connector can be used with the Autocarrier. The Autocarrier has a standard 3-pin 3.5mm headphone jack connection for the camera. You need an adapter cable from your cameras remote trigger connector to 3.5mm headphone jack. Such adapter cables are available for most camera models.
Is the light source exchangeable?
The light source is fixed and can not be exchanged.
Which lens can be recommended?
The lens needs to have the correct magnification ratio. If you want to scan 35mm film with a full frame camera, you need a lens capable of 1:1 magnification ratio. Focal length should be around 100mm to minimise distortion. A good budget lens is the LAOWA 100mm 2:1 APO Macro. For maximum performance, I recommend using my industrial IR-lens. It offers exceptional sharpness, zero distortion, and can also be used with the IR-Ready Autocarriers for automatic dust removal.
Can the 135-Autocarrier do full border scans?
The Autocarrier scans “full frame”, that means it shows the full image plus a little border. “Full border scans”, which include the sprocket holes, are not possible with the 135-Autocarrier.
Can the 120-Autocarrier be used for 135?
No, the 120-Autocarrier can only be used for 120 film, as the transport rollers are at fixed distance.
